Tips for Choosing a emergency locksmith in Sallybrook

Whether you are locked out of your car, home, or need a brand-new set of locks installed, you’ll want to be sure to employ a credible locksmith. BBB suggests finding a trusted locksmith before one is required.

Locksmithing usually requires some type of apprenticeship, though official education can differ anywhere from a certificate to a diploma from an engineering college. Locksmiths can have a physical storefront or be mobile. Numerous locksmiths deal with not simply locks themselves, however other existing door hardware, consisting of door hinges, frame repair work, or making secrets. Associated Locksmiths of America (aloa.org) is a global company of locksmiths and other physical security professionals. There is an application process, background check, and application and charges costs which must exist in order to sign up with.

Tips for Choosing a Locksmith:

  • Request for Recommendations. Contact friends, member of the family, and next-door neighbors for recommendations of trustworthy locksmiths in your location. Be sure to verify the physical address of any locksmith you discover and ensure the address is really regional. See bbb.org/indy for a listing of recognized locksmiths, to read BBB Business Reviews and Customer Reviews from previous customers. Ensure the business does not have any unanswered/unresolved complaints.
  • Call the Business. Beware if the business addresses the phone with a generic expression like “locksmith services”. Ask exactly what their legal service name is and if they are not able to give it to you, look somewhere else for a locksmith. Try to find a business that responds to the phone with their particular business name.
  • Ask for an Estimate. Before having the locksmith come to your house or car, make sure to obtain an estimate that consists of the cost of all labor and the replacement parts for the lock. Reputable locksmiths will be able to give you a quote over the phone.
  • Ask about extra fees consisting of: if you will be charged additional for services in the middle of the night or weekends or if there is a charge by the millage they should take a trip. If once the locksmith arrives they are charging a greater cost than on the phone, don’t enable them to begin working. Take care to never sign a blank file to license work.
  • Examine Credentials. Make certain that the locksmith you employ is guaranteed so you will be covered in case the repair work causes damages. Upon arrival, ask the locksmith to supply recognition and/or a company card. It’s likewise important to examine if business name and logo design on their business cards match the name and logo on the invoice and vehicle. A respectable locksmith will likewise request to see your identification to make sure it’s in fact your house they are doing deal with.
  • Conserve Their Information. After the locksmith has completed the job, get an itemized invoice that includes: parts, labor, mileage, and other charges and save this file for future referral. If you believe you have found a reliable locksmith, you need to keep business’ name and details stored in your wallet or mobile phone in case their services are needed in the future.

Possible Scam Scenarios

  • Offering a low price for the fix and after that raising the rate on the labor or including mileage expenditure to the task.
  • Claiming a lock is not able to be picked, then drilling it off and changing it with a pricey replacement lock.
    Using a local, genuine locksmith business info such as an address and/or a similar sounding name when business is really located in another city or state.
  • Spoofing any regional phone number, when your call is really directed to a call center who then provides a “mobile technician.”
    Whether it’s for a planned house enhancement, or an emergency situation lock-out circumstance, using a credible locksmith is necessary. Do your homework before hiring a locksmith for non-emergency scenarios and have a locksmith’s contact details that you have already researched useful for those emergency situation scenarios.

Sallybrook (Irish: Gleann Sailí, meaning “valley of the willows”) is a small village on the outskirts of Cork City, Ireland. It is in the townland of Knocknahorgan on the River Glashaboy (Glasa Bhuì).[1]

The main village has twenty houses which date back over 150 years, and were originally part of the Smith Barry Estate situated on Fota Island near Cobh, in Cork Harbour. Workmen and their families were permitted to live there until the breaking up of the Estate, at which point residents were able to purchase their homes. The houses are in one row, with only one break after number 10.
